A222307 Write down the nonprime numbers 1, 4, 6, 8, 9, 10, 12, 14, 15, 16, 18, ... and insert between two nonprimes the smallest prime not yet present in the sequence such that two neighboring integers sum to a nonprime. 3
1, 5, 4, 2, 6, 19, 8, 7, 9, 11, 10, 23, 12, 13, 14, 31, 15, 17, 16, 47, 18, 37, 20, 29, 21, 3, 22, 41, 24, 53, 25, 43, 26, 59, 27, 67, 28, 89, 30, 61, 32, 73, 33, 71, 34, 83, 35, 79, 36, 97, 38, 103, 39, 101, 40, 113, 42, 127, 44, 109, 45, 107, 46, 137, 48, 139, 49, 151, 50, 157, 51, 131, 52, 149 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; text; internal format)
